Marc Notes: Includes bibliographical references and index. Contributor Bio: Robbins, Vernon K Vernon K. Robbins is professor of New Testament and comparative sacred texts at Emory University, Atlanta, where he has taught for twenty-nine years. Among his other books areJesus the Teacher: A Socio-Rhetorical Interpretation of Mark, The Invention of Christian Discourse, and Sea Voyages and Beyond: Emerging Strategies in Socio-Rhetorical Interpretation
